π ~1 min read
Table of contents
Symptom & Impact
Node stays NotReady and workloads cannot schedule reliably.
Environment & Reproduction
Follows runtime upgrades or kubelet config drift.
Root Cause Analysis
Container runtime and kubelet use different cgroup driver modes.
Quick Triage
Check kubelet status and runtime driver configuration parity.
Step-by-Step Diagnosis
Inspect kubelet flags, runtime config, and node event logs.

Solution – Primary Fix
Align cgroup driver settings and restart kubelet/runtime components.
Still having issues? Our IT Solutions & Services team can diagnose and resolve this for you. Get in touch for a free consultation.

Solution – Alternative Approaches
Drain node and rejoin with clean bootstrap configuration.
Verification & Acceptance Criteria
Node reaches Ready and pods run without repeated restarts.
Rollback Plan
Revert to previous runtime/kubelet versions if mismatch persists.
Prevention & Hardening
Enforce immutable node configuration baselines for cluster agents.
Related Errors & Cross-Refs
Often paired with CRI socket and kubelet bootstrap certificate issues.
Related tutorial: View the step-by-step tutorial for debian-10.
View all debian-10 tutorials on the Tutorials Hub β
Browse all common problems & solutions on the Tutorials Hub.
References & Further Reading
Kubernetes kubelet and runtime cgroup driver documentation.
Need Expert Help?
If you cannot resolve this yourself, our team offers hands-on Server Management, Managed IT Services, and flexible Support Plans. Contact us today β we respond within one business day.